Ok, so I need to go for a walk and have a think. any thoughts appreciated.
FTSE has run up to 7800 but most of my stocks have not risen with anything like the strength of that rise as the rise is driven by commodities (oil). I have mostly construction, banks and property.
However, my stocks are up and some of the rises are decent enough. I've sold a tiny amount so far.
I am trying to decide whether to sell some more. AV. for example I bought at 494 including costs and it's now 570 if I add the dividend. That's 15% in a couple of months, yet I feel the tone of the market has changed. In the scheme of things 15% could just be the start of the rise, but on the other hand 15% is nice enough if I can do rinse and repeat.
My stocks which are going up fastest I don't want to sell. I have a much higher level of conviction on their value.
My gut feel is the market is going to continue up, as the economic data will improve, so that tells me to sit tight and do nothing.
Doing nothing is hard work!
